Цикл v-for не отображает никаких данных, он просто повторяет строки таблицы - PullRequest
0 голосов
/ 20 сентября 2018

этот цикл v-for просто повторяет строки таблицы столько раз без отображения каких-либо данных.

 <table class="table">
 <thead>
 <th>Id</th>
 <th>Name</th>
 </thead>
 <tbody>
 <tr v-for="t in tasks ">
 <td>{{ t.id }}</td>
 <td>{{ t.name }}</td>
 </tr>
 </tbody>
 </table>

вот моя функция контроллера, откуда я пытаюсь вернуть данные json

public function index()
{
    $tasks = Todo::all();
    return request()->json($tasks, 200);
}

вот сценарий, и он не показывает ошибки на консоли

<script>
export default {
  data(){
    return{
      tasks:{},
    }
  },
  methods:{
  },
  created(){
    axios.get('http://127.0.0.1:8000/#/example/tasks')
    .then((response) => this.tasks = response.data )
    .catch((error) => console.log(error));
    console.log("Tasks Component Mounted.....");
  }
}
</script>
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...